Strategic Placement and Layout Considerations

While the asset is robust, strategic placement is key to maintaining visual hierarchy. In large layout areas, such as website banners or poster backdrops, the 3D elements command attention effectively. They work beautifully as decorative accents around central typography, framing content without overwhelming it.

However, caution is required in specific scenarios. In minimalist branding or corporate materials where clean visual hierarchy is paramount, these elements might introduce too much visual noise. Similarly, in crowded layouts or low-contrast designs, the subtle shading of the 3D effect can get lost. Designers should avoid using these assets at very small sizes, such as favicon icons or tiny social media avatars, where detail loss will occur. For sticker design or intricate Cricut projects, ensure the machine resolution can handle the fine details of the cut lines.

Technical Workflow and Quality Checks

Before committing to any graphic design asset for a paid client, rigorous testing is non-negotiable. Here are the critical steps I took when evaluating the Fathers Day Elements 3D SVG:

  1. Format Inspection: Since the download includes SVG in a zipped folder, I verified the vector integrity. Clean paths and editable nodes are essential for resizing without pixelation. The collection is easy to cut on your silhouette studio and Cricut design space software, which simplifies the transition from digital file to physical product.
  2. Contrast Testing: I placed the elements on both light and dark backgrounds. On white backgrounds, the shadows provided excellent depth. On dark charcoal backgrounds, I had to adjust the highlight colors slightly to maintain legibility and brand consistency.
  3. Typography Pairing: To test compatibility, I paired the 3D shapes with various font styles. A sturdy sans serif font balanced the modern look, while a handwritten font added a personal touch for gift-focused campaigns. Script fonts worked well for elegant invitations, whereas display font styles clashed with the industrial vibe of some elements.
  4. Mockup Integration: I previewed the graphics on real product mockups, including mugs and wooden signs. This step revealed how the sublimation design would interact with curved surfaces, ensuring the final result felt polished and professional.
  5. Print Quality: For clients ordering physical goods, I checked the output at 300 DPI equivalent scaling. The vector nature ensured no blurring, which is vital for high-quality printable design outputs.
